Silversea Christens New Flagship, Silver Muse

By: Caribbean Journal Staff - April 21, 2017 - 2:37 pm

Luxury cruise line Silversea has christened its new flagship, Silver Muse.

The new ship, the ninth in Silversea’s fleet, was unveiled at a ceremony in Monte Carlo this week hosted by Silversea Chairman Manfredi Lefebvre d’Ovidio.

The ship, which accommodates 596 guests, has three restaurants new to the brand, including Atlantide, a seafood concept; Asian-style Indochine and Italian-themed poolside eatery Spaccanapoli.

The ship also includes a Zagara Beauty Spa.

“On behalf of the Principality of Monaco I would like to extend a warm welcome to Silver Muse, its crew and passengers. She represents the next generation of cruise ships in both fuel efficiency and energy saving technology,” said Prince Albert II of Monaco. “We share with Silversea common values and principles in relation with responsible environmental practices and the development of a sustainable business activity. The preservation of the oceans is a crucial priority for future generations.”

Silversea Muse’s first Caribbean sailings will include a pair of cruises out of Fort Lauderdale in December and March and a cruise out of Bridgetown, Barbados.
